Private Lessons vs. Group Training
Choosing between private lessons and group sessions depends on a player’s needs. Private lessons provide one-on-one coaching, allowing for personalized instruction and faster progress. This is ideal for kids who need extra attention or want to sharpen specific skills. On the other hand, group training builds social skills and teaches players how to adapt to different playing styles.
